#e4af06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4af06 is composed of 89.4% red, 68.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 45.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#e4af06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#c95f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#e4af06 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e4af06 has RGB values of R:228, G:175,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.97,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14987014.

Hex triplet e4af06 #e4af06
RGB Decimal 228, 175, 6 rgb(228,175,6)
RGB Percent 89.4, 68.6, 2.4 rgb(89.4%,68.6%,2.4%)
CMYK 0, 23, 97, 11
HSL 45.7°, 94.9, 45.9 hsl(45.7,94.9%,45.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 45.7°, 97.4, 89.4
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 74.298, 7.175, 76.404
XYZ 47.359, 47.17, 6.783
xyY 0.467, 0.466, 47.17
CIE-LCH 74.298, 76.74, 84.635
CIE-LUV 74.298, 44.926, 76.558
Hunter-Lab 68.68, 2.895, 42.221
Binary 11100100, 10101111, 00000110

Shades and Tints of #e4af06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120e00 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4af06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787772 is the less saturated color, while #e4af06 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e4af06 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#acacac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b7ad8b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d1ba16 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e9b115 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#eea7b2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d8b610 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e7b010 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#eaaa73 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
